#ff68d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ff68d8 is composed of 100% red, 40.8%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 15.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 315.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 70.4%. #ff68d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#ff00b1.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ff68d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ff68d8 has RGB values of R:255, G:104,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.15, K:0. Its decimal value is 16738520.

Shades and Tints of #ff68d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060004 is the darkest color, while #fff1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ff68d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9aeb6 is the less saturated color, while #ff68d8 is the most saturated one.
